The physical shape doesn't influence what is is chemically. Pure iron (Fe) is an element regardless of the shape. Strictly speaking an iron rod is probably an alloy. Mostly iron, but with a dab of other elements to make it stronger and easier to shape.

The Iron rod(Fe) reacts with the Copper Sulphate. Substitution reaction takes place. Fe+CuSO4--> FeSO4 + Cu
Why does the colour of copper sulphate solution change when an iron nail is dipped in it? When an iron nail is placed in a copper sulphate solution, iron displaces copper from copper sulphate solution forming iron sulphate, which is green in colour. Therefore, the blue colour of copper sulphate solution fades and green colour appears.
